  • Abstract
    A single point slack mooring with elastic accumulator has been evaluated using a finite element dynamic computer program. Various current and wave regimens were run to determine steady-state and dynamic loads. The use of a new design of elastic accumulator with a loose nylon overbraid is evaluated. This design provides a high breaking strength after the designed elastic limit of the accumulator is reached.
